Determining Sample Size

1) Before attempting this assignment, review Chapter 6 of the text.

2) Complete for the scenarios below:

Step 1: Estimate the target population size using secondary sources. Provide a rationale for how you determined each population size. Cite your sources.

Step 2: Use the sample size calculator found in the Student Resources section of the courseware (Chapter 6) to determine an appropriate sample size for each scenario. Use the market research standard for your confidence level. Use better than the market research standard for your confidence interval. Adjust if your sample size is not realistically attainable.

Report your sample size statement. Your statement should read: "For this study, the target population size is estimated to be _____. The sample will be _____.
At the ______ confidence level, this study will have a margin of error of +/- ____%."

Scenario 1

A study calls for your research firm to survey a sample of Disneyland employees.

Scenario 2

A study calls for your research firm to survey a sample of American Indian residents in El Paso, Texas.

Scenario 3

A study calls for your research firm to survey a sample of those likely to purchase a tablet in the United States within the next year.
